Polestar Banned from US Market Over Chinese Software

By Meridian48 News Desk · Summarised from The Verge ·

Polestar will be barred from selling its EVs in the US for model year 2027 and beyond after the federal government denied its request under a new rule targeting vehicles with Chinese software. The company announced its retreat from the US market following the decision. The rule aims to restrict technology from China in connected vehicles.
